WebThey conducted a series of experiments that led them to discover the bystander effect, the theory that the more witnesses to an event, the less likely it is that any one of them will intervene, in the expectation that someone else has already responded, or will. WebFeb 24, 2024 · The Bystander was founded on 9 December 1903 and covered an array of topics: literary and theatre news, politics, foreign affairs, and sports. The weekly … lexmark printer 3 in 1 amazon 120WebThe Bystander was founded on 9 December 1903 and covered an array of topics: literary and theatre news, politics, foreign affairs, and sports. The weekly publication’s intended audience was the upper-middle and upper classes.
